Capacity note for on-call: the Stonevale monorepo's migration to the Cloistr hermetic build system roughly doubles peak disk usage per worker because each sandbox materializes its own toolchain. Watch the Pellman pool during the 02:00 batch window and page build-infra if eviction rates climb. The approved tuning constants for the rollout are as follows.

limits module of fajog-tawig:
RATE_LIMITS = {
    "druwyn": 2,
    "quenael": 10,
    "wenix": 2,
    "druael": 2,
}

Branch managers: capital outlay for the Hartvale expansion came in 4% under forecast. Two sites secured, third pending zoning approval. Staffing costs tracked to plan; fit-out overruns absorbed by contingency. Revenue ramp expected from month five, slower than the Corwick launch but within tolerance. Q3 targets for existing branches are unaffected; do not reallocate headcount without finance approval. Cash position remains adequate for phase two if the board approves. The strategic context for that decision follows below.

board note of bawep-tajef: Queniusek Systems plans to raise the Quenvan list price by 53.1 percent in March. The pricing group signed off on a budget of $176.4 million for Project Drueth. The renewal with Casionix Partners closes at $142.5 million a year, 8.3 percent below the last contract. Project Fraax slips by six weeks because of the tooling delay.

Runbook 4.2 — Locked device case. The Torvane test units travel in the orange hard case, padlocked, stored in bay C until collection. Verify the lock is engaged, record the case weight on the manifest, and keep the case within sight until the Pellwick courier signs the transfer sheet. At sign-off, relay the following confidential instruction to the courier word for word.

handover note for yagef-bagep: the drudor pelius courier leaves the kasdor zorvan norir ledger at gate 8016 under passcode 755406